What is incident.io?

Nexus does the diagnosis; the rest is on-call plumbing

Investigations went generally available in early August: Nexus posts a root-cause hypothesis and its evidence into the incident channel within minutes of declaration. Around it the on-call layer keeps filling in — coverage policies that flag gaps in a rota, escalation reassignment, shift swapping, private incidents scoped to whole teams. Insights picked up 'match any' filtering, and MCP plus the macOS app reached GA in July.

What is Pipedream?

Pipedream put OAuth on its 10,000-tool MCP server and annotated every tool read or write.

Two releases account for all six entries, each duplicated three times across the marketing and docs changelogs. In October 2025 Pipedream's MCP server moved to OAuth authentication on a static endpoint, became usable from ChatGPT, and gained tool annotations across more than 10,000 tools so clients can distinguish read operations from destructive writes, with no per-app pre-setup. A month earlier, Connect gained Python, TypeScript and Java SDKs and rewritten interactive documentation. Nothing has published since.

◆ Where it's heading

The agent has moved from something you ask to something that acts the moment an incident opens, while everything else hardens the scheduling and escalation machinery beneath it. Coverage policies and vacation conflict checks point at an on-call product being pushed toward guarantees rather than rotas you hope are correct.

◆ Prediction

Expect Nexus to reach past the hypothesis into the work that follows it — suggested actions, post-incident drafting — and more policy checks that catch scheduling gaps before an incident finds them.

◆ Where it's heading

Both releases point away from Pipedream as a workflow product people sit in and toward Pipedream as the integration substrate other people's agents call. Annotating every tool with read/write/destructive metadata is the unglamorous prerequisite for letting an autonomous client act without a human confirming each step, and OAuth on a static URL is what makes that catalog addressable from a third-party host.

◆ Prediction

The feed has been static for ten months, so a confident prediction isn't supported; on the visible pattern, whatever ships next is most likely on the Connect and MCP side, since both visible releases landed there.
